With a wealth of features not found in the more basic Labtec 1200 and 2200 Labtec webcams for laptops and PCs, the Labtec Webcam Pro is a budget-friendly, yet feature-intensive webcam that provides more overall satisfaction for just about double the price of either the 1200 or 2200. It is still available in the market, despite the fact that this model has been around for some time, and budget-conscious webcam customers should certainly take this product into consideration the next time they go shopping.
The Labtec Webcam Pro’s basic features include video capture for up to a 640 x 480 resolution, still image capture up to 1280 x 960, a built-in microphone, a VGA CMOS sensor that allows you to increase the resolution of your videos and pictures, and a manual focus lens. A built-in microphone enhances the sound, which is quite an improvement over the 1200 and 2200. Those with lower-end systems can certainly use the Webcam Pro – system requirements for the Webcam Pro are Pentium III PC with 500 MHz or better processor speed, Windows 98, ME, 2000 or XP, a USB port, a CD-ROM drive for installation, at least 75 MB of hard drive space and at least 128 MB RAM.
Let it be known that this is still an older model and a lot of newer webcams for laptops feature a whole lot more than this old Labtec Webcam Pro. Support for newer operating systems like Windows 7 are unfortunately not available on this webcam. Still, if it’s cheap webcams you want, you can’t get much better than the Webcam Pro, as it works with a lot of popular chat programs, including Yahoo! and MSN Messenger, AOL Instant Messenger, Windows Messenger and AIM. And as an added feature, the Webcam Pro includes motion detection software that allows you to use it as a security tool as well. Not bad for only about $20 to $30 worth of webcam!
